ACDL — IAM Policy Baseline (v1.11, REQ-116)

Source of truth: terraform/bootstrap/spike_runner_policy.json. Applied as: customer-managed policy acdl-spike-runner-policy (ARN arn:aws:iam::581513795199:policy/acdl-spike-runner-policy), v1. Regression-tested by: tests/test_iam_policy_baseline.py (Phase 56). Applied: 2026-07-28, Phase 56 live step (D-095 resolved — fresh root key provided by the user).

The acdl-spike-runner IAM user is the principal that runs the ACDL platform pipeline (plan + apply) against account 581513795199. This document is the baseline of the permissions it holds, scoped to the minimum required for the v1.11 milestone (Operating Model + Deploy Verification, REQ-116..122). Any future grant must be documented here and covered by the baseline test.

Managed-policy note (v1.11 Phase 56). The original v1.1 bootstrap applied this policy as an inline user policy (iam:put_user_policy). The v1.11 extension grew the policy document beyond the 2048-byte inline limit (5917 bytes), so Phase 56 converted it to a customer-managed policy (iam:create_policy + attach_user_policy) with the same name acdl-spike-runner-policy. The managed-policy path supports 6144 bytes per version + up to 5 versions, leaving room for future growth. The inline policy was deleted after the managed policy was attached. The same managed policy is also attached to the acdl-act-runner-role (CAP-022) so the OIDC runner inherits the spike-runner-equivalent permissions once act_runner adoption lands.

Least-privilege scoping notes

  • CloudFront/WAF/KMS/CE/OIDC use Resource: "*" because these services use account-scoped or global ARNs that cannot be resource- restricted at the statement level. Scope is bounded by the action list (e.g. only ce:Get* read actions for Cost Explorer; no ce:* write because CE has no write surface).
  • Lambda is scoped to function:acdl-* — only ACDL-owned functions, not all functions in the account.
  • DynamoDB is scoped to acdl-contracts + acdl-change-requests in addition to the original acdl-outbox grant. The spike-runner cannot touch other tables in the account.
  • Secrets Manager is scoped to secret:acdl/* — only ACDL-owned secrets.
  • SNS is scoped to acdl-* topic names.
  • No iam:PassRole to * — the original iam:PassRole grant is scoped to iam::581513795199:* (account roles only); the v1.11 grant does not extend it.
